Gel Food Coloring Eggs - Prepare the jars with food coloring. Place 5 drops of gel paste coloring (10 drops for yellow or light colors), or use 20 drops of liquid food coloring and mix well. To each container, carefully add 1 to 1 ½ cups boiling water. Web dying eggs with gel food coloring. Stir 1 tablespoon vinegar into each. Do not overfill them and remember to allow room for the egg.
